It is easy to maintain.

uPVC is very easy to maintain and looks like new for a long time after installation. It is a strong weather-resistant, weatherproof material that is not affected by water. It also looks good with a range of finishes and colours. It is also low maintenance and requires only the use of a few cleaning products. The majority of these are likely things you already have.

To clean your uPVC windows and doors, start by making sure that you are using a non-scratch cloth. This will prevent the window frames from getting damaged, which can lead to a poor finish. Also, avoid washing the windows in direct sunlight, as this will create streaks. You can also apply a mild household cleaner and wipe the windows' surface using a dry cloth or a soft brush.

If your uPVC has spots you can clean it using a mixture of warm water and dishwashing soap. This will get rid of dirt and stains, making your windows look great again. Alternately, you can make use of commercial glass cleaners and scrubber to get rid of staining that is difficult to remove. Make sure to wipe the glass in circular motions to avoid unsightly scratches.

It is also important to conduct routine maintenance on your uPVC window's mechanical components particularly if you live in an environment that is corrosive. This could be due to living near the ocean or near an water treatment facility, or in an area that has high pollution levels. Performing this maintenance twice a year should keep the mechanical components of your uPVC running smoothly.

It is important to lubricate the moving parts of your windows, in addition to cleaning the uPVC. This will stop corrosion and extend the lifespan of the uPVC. You can also grease the hinges to ensure that they move smoothly.


You should also reseal your uPVC frames and sills after cleaning them. This will ensure that the seal is in good condition and guards against leaks of cold air. Reapply silicone if you notice any gaps. This will restore the seal to its original condition. This will also help prevent water from entering which could damage the uPVC over time.
